Two bodies missing in Gulmi landslide retrieved



GULMI: The bodies of two people missing in a landslide that occurred in Ishma rural municipality-2 in Gulmi district have been recovered.

A rescue team of Nepal Army recovered  the bodies of 39-year-old Prem Bahadur Kumal and five-year-old Safal Kumal.

Thye had gone missing after  they were buried by a landslide that occurred on  at 8:30 pm yesterday, said District Police Office, Gulmi.

Another person who was walking on the road was rescued safely, said DPO, Gulmi.
